Chemistry Check: Do Your Values And Goals Align?
Start with what matters beyond attraction: shared values, life rhythms, and where you both want to go. Chemistry is more than heat — it’s how well two lives can fit together over time. Use this guide to turn curiosity into clarity when dating Latin singles on Mingle2.
Talk About Core Values
Ask gentle, open questions about family, work ethic, faith or spirituality, and what honesty and loyalty look like to each of you. Listen for examples, not slogans. If one person prioritizes weekly family dinners and the other treats family time as occasional, that difference can matter later.
Check Lifestyle Fit
Compare daily routines and priorities early. Discuss typical weekdays and weekends, travel desires, social life, and nightlife. Small mismatches — like one person needing quiet mornings and the other loving late-night gatherings — can be managed if acknowledged, but they’re worth raising before things get serious.
Clarify Relationship Goals
Be direct about what you want: casual dating, exclusivity, long-term partnership, or marriage. People may move at different speeds; knowing whether you both see a future prevents misunderstandings. It’s okay to revisit goals as the relationship evolves.
Observe Communication Styles
Notice how you handle disagreements and emotional conversations. Do you both prefer direct talk, or do you need time to process before responding? Share how you like to give and receive feedback, and agree on safe words or pauses for heated moments so conversations stay respectful.
Set And Respect Boundaries
Talk about personal boundaries: time alone, social media, finances, family involvement, and physical intimacy. State your own limits clearly and invite your partner to do the same. Boundaries are not rejection — they’re a map to safer connection.
Questions That Spark Real Conversation
- What does a meaningful weekend look like to you?
- How do you handle stress or disappointment?
- What role does family play in your life, and how often do you see them?
- Where would you like to be in five years personally and professionally?
- How do you show care when someone is upset?
Use these questions as a starting point rather than a script. Pay attention to consistency between words and actions over several meetings. Chemistry matters, but the best matches balance attraction with shared values, compatible routines, and honest communication.
Dating Confidence Reset
Start by getting clear about what you actually want. Decide whether you’re looking for casual conversations, friendship, or a potential relationship, and write down two or three nonnegotiables and two qualities you’re willing to be flexible on. Clear intent helps you recognize good matches faster and say no to directionless interactions without second-guessing yourself.
Pace conversations with purpose. Treat early chats like fact-finding missions, not instant chemistry tests. Ask one or two meaningful questions, share a small detail about yourself, and pause to notice how the other person responds. If a conversation stays curious and consistent across a few messages, it’s worth moving toward a call or real-time chat. If it fizzles or feels one-sided, it’s okay to step back.
Keep expectations realistic. Online dating increases options and also stretches timelines. Expect some matches to be slow to reply, some conversations to stall, and occasional rejection. That doesn’t mean you’re failing — it’s part of the process. Focus on small markers of progress: thoughtful replies, shared plans for a short chat, or exchanged photos that feel natural.
Measure progress, not volume. Avoid the numbers-game trap of judging success by likes or matches alone. Instead, track actions that matter to you: started conversations that lasted more than three messages, profiles you felt genuinely curious about, or meetups that taught you something. A smaller number of higher-quality interactions builds confidence faster than dozens of shallow ones.
Protect your emotional bandwidth. Set simple rules: limit daily app time, take regular breaks, and don’t read every reply as a verdict on your worth. When a conversation ends or a match disappears, treat it as data — what does it tell you about compatibility or your preferences? Use that lesson and move on without rehashing the disappointment.
Choose matches with intention. Use your nonnegotiables and flexible traits to filter profiles and openers. Look for people who mirror your conversational rhythm, show curiosity, and communicate boundaries. When you decide someone isn’t right, close the exchange politely and preserve energy for people who align with your goals.
